Abstract
The Thomson elm was selected on the basis of form, superior vigor and hardiness from a Japanese elm shelterbelt located on the PFRA Tree Nursery, Indian Head, Saskatchewan. Inoculation tests conducted by the Canadian Forestry Service. Sault Ste. Marie, Ontario, have shown that this Asiatic elm is resistant to Dutch elm disease.Keywords
